Haagen Dazs
The health department has logged four inspections at Haagen Dazs, the earliest from 2022. The newest entry in the record is dated Aug 26, 2025. Medium risk typically reflects a handful of issues that inspectors wrote up but didn't deem critical.
The picture has improved over the last few visits: recent inspections have averaged around six violations, down from roughly eight violations earlier in the record.
When inspectors have written things up, “no paper towels” has been the most frequent reason, cited three times.
Restaurants in Hialeah average 76, so Haagen Dazs trails the local norm. On the whole, the file is mixed but not concerning.
